Global Connections

- An international organization for all SMU students.

Purpose

The purpose of our organization is to provide opportunities for all undergraduate and graduate students, foreign and domestic, to come together and build relationships with one another, learn about different cultures and ways of life, and support each other while attending Southern Methodist University.
